Other than that, Fireflies-Watching is also one of the main attractions during summer in Japan. Fireflies inhabit only in areas with pure water and grass.
Recently, the number of fireflies in Japan have been decreasing sharply. It is due to pollution of the rivers and other destruction to the natural environment.

Firefly imagoes rest under the shade of overgrown grass during the day and start moving at night. Therefore, this is the only time when we are able to watch them.

Fireflies have a short life span of about 2 - 3 weeks and they live only in summer.
During this period of time, both children and adults would wait patiently along the river for the precious crowd of fireflies to arrive.
